Govt may list 5 units of world's top coal miner Coal India
short by Dharna / on Wednesday, 17 July, 2019
The government may reportedly list units of state-run Coal India (CIL), the world's largest coal miner, as separate companies to raise government funds and boost competition. Reports said the Coal Ministry is studying a proposal to list CIL's four production coalfields, constituting over three-fourths of its output, and its exploration unit. In 2017, think-tank NITI Aayog suggested a similar move.
